Advancing the tap half a trun of so and then backing it out is a great idea. I always do this. I like to clamp the item to be threaded under the drill press, drill the hole, then chuck the tap into the drill press and manually turn it in. The drill press keeps the tap straight and true to the hole, and you can focus on slowly cutting the hole and not breaking the tap off. Do not try to tap the hole with the drill press under power, I pull the plug and open the belt cover and use the pulleys to turn the drill chuck by hand. Works every time, in all metals.
